Grants paid by The Vanderboom Family Charitable Foundation

EIN 32-6452810 · Naples, FL · Form 990-PF, Part XV · NTEE T20

The Vanderboom Family Charitable Foundation of Naples, FL (EIN 32-6452810) reported 5 grants paid totaling $956,823 to 2 recipients in tax years 2020–2024, on Form 990-PF, Part XV. Derived from IRS e-file data, dataset version 2026.09.0, built 2026-09-03.
